Serena Potter was born in Los Angeles, California. She received her BFA from the University of Utah and her MFA in painting from Laguna College of Art and Design, where she is currently a mentor in their MFA in painting program. She teaches Art History and Drawing at National University, Drawing at Mt. San Antonio Community College. Her paintings are included in private collections throughout the United States, Europe and Mexico, as well as in the permanent collection of the Hilbert Museum of California Art. She recently had a solo show at Lois Lambert Gallery in Santa Monica, CA and an artist residency and The Long Beach Museum of Art.
